Garlic: August through … Witryna20 maj 2024 · Chocolate mint tastes sweet. Pineapple mint, well, you get the idea. If you don’t want it to take over the garden (and it will!), plant in a pot sunk into the ground to contain its spread. Add a sprig to lemonade, or chop and toss with home fries. Bonus: Mint is one of those plants that naturally repels mosquitoes.
